Job summary
Distro seeks a Crisis Mobile Response Clinician in Michigan to manage behavioral health crises. Responsibilities include assessing situations, collaborating with law enforcement, and developing safety plans for individuals in distress. Candidates must hold a bachelor's or master's degree in relevant fields with appropriate Michigan licenses. Proficiency in Microsoft Office is also required. This role demands strong crisis management and assessment capabilities and a minimum of two years' experience with co-occurring populations.
